Frequently Asked Questions about the 82615 ZIP Code
How much are Studio apartments in 82615?
There are currently 10 Studio Apartments in 82615 with rent ranges from $729 to $1,414 with an average price of $941.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om 82615 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in 82615 ranges from $535 to $1,746 with an average monthly rent of $988.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in 82615 c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in 82615 range from $800 to $2,443.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,272.
